County 'broke law' to buy governor Sh19m fuel guzzler

The County Government broke public finance management regulations when it bought the governor a top of the range car, auditors have revealed.

In his report for fiscal year 2017/18, Auditor General Edward Ouko said the county spent Sh19, 419,280 on a vehicle registered as GVN013B.
